Late singer Robert Palmer is being remembered in a tribute concert voiced by his little brother MARK PALMER.

The 44-year-old, who is an engineer for Britain's ROYAL AIR FORCE, is set to reenact his famous sibling's hits, such as Addicted to Love.

The concert will be held in the English sea side town of Scarborough where Robert - who died in September (03) of a heart-attack - spent his teenage years.

His mother ANN gave her blessing for the concert saying, "Mark was in a band when he was younger and he's started playing again in his spare time, so I'm sure he'll do very well."

The line up for the Good Friday (09APR04) gig includes THE MANDRAKES, the band Robert joined whilst still a teenager.
